Subject: cogito: missing *.txt files in Documentation/tutorial-script
Date: Wed, 02 Nov 2005 18:07:30 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1130972850.23026.11.camel@dv> (raw)
Hello!
Following files are missing in cogito:
Documentation/tutorial-script/0002-alice-license.txt
Documentation/tutorial-script/0009-alice-README.txt
Documentation/tutorial-script/0020-alice-CONTRIBUTORS.txt
I believe they weren't committed because *.txt is ignored in
Documentation/.gitignore
You may want to add Documentation/tutorial-script/.gitignore and put
following line in it:
!*.txt
